    Beanstalk, a global brand extension agency and consultancy, extends brands through the strategic and creative development of licensed products. The company works with corporate brands, celebrities, entertainment properties, and other high-profile clients to leverage licensing as a strategic tool to enhance brand awareness, increase consumer touchpoints, and generate revenue. Current Beanstalk clients include Procter & Gamble, Diageo, Taco Bell, Godiva, Stanley Black and Decker, Microsoft Studios, among others.

    Beanstalk seeks a Licensing Coordinator to join our team in New York. The role will support the development and growth of several of our clients' licensing programs into different product categories with a focus on DIY, Hard Goods and Sports. This is an amazing opportunity to play an integral role in a variety of our global business', working with prominent, power-house brands including Stanley Black and Decker and U.S. Army.

    Responsibilities include:

    • Support account teams in every aspect of the development of licensing programs
    • Research product categories, trends, and industries
    • Assist in the development of sales materials and presentations
    • Develop and manage lists of potential products and partners and support sales initiatives
    • Support sales initiatives and ability to conduct outreach to manufactures
    • Support product development by managing the product and packaging approval process to ensure direction, guidance and feedback
    • Collect and analyze licensee forecast
    • Assist in management of licensees' programs (product, distribution, marketing)
    • Support day-to-day needs of internal Business Unit, clients and licensees

    We are seeking a candidate with at least 1-2 years' experience in a related position with licensing experience preferred or a background in a sales oriented environment. Candidate should possess and interest in DIY, Hard Goods, Sports and Collegiate. Candidate must have strong communication, writing, and organizational skills, advanced knowledge of Power Point and other graphic programs. The successful candidate will be detail-oriented, a self-starter with strong interpersonal skills to interact with high-level executives.

    Salary range: mid 50's - mid 60's + bonus - Actual salary is commensurate with experience and will vary based on numerous factors.
